Life Conduct; As Sikh Scriptures put it!
Sikh scriptures as enshrined in the holy book of Shri Guru Granth Sahib (SGGS) show the humanity a beautiful and practical set of code of life conduct. Besides describing the Almighty God and its manifestations, SGGS lists out the qualities and virtues to lead one’s life in a noble way. I would attempt to highlight […]

Social Grace; Setting Priorities Right!
The term social grace constitutes a set of skills required to interact in society which includes general public as well as one’s family. It includes social responsibilities and responses like etiquette. manners, communications, politeness and maturity.
